APM-MIB
The MIB module for measuring application performance
as experienced by end-users.
Copyright (C) The Internet Society (2004). This version of
this MIB module is part of RFC 3729; see the RFC itself for
full legal notices.

Net-SNMP examples using the rfc MIB directory Show commands
These commands use the standard Observium installation path and load the selected MIB variant before the RFC and Net-SNMP directories.
Translate the module identity
/usr/bin/snmptranslate -Pud -Ir -On -m 'APM-MIB' -M '/opt/observium/mibs/rfc:/opt/observium/mibs/net-snmp' 'APM-MIB::apm'
Walk the MIB subtree
/usr/bin/snmpbulkwalk -v2c -c '<community>' -Pud -Ir -OQUs -m 'APM-MIB' -M '/opt/observium/mibs/rfc:/opt/observium/mibs/net-snmp' 'udp:<hostname>:161' 'APM-MIB::apm'

Notifications / Traps (2)
| Name | OID | Description |
|---|---|---|
.1.3.6.1.2.1.16.23.0.1 |
Notification sent when a transaction exceeds a threshold
defined in the apmException table. The index of the included apmExceptionResponsivenessThreshold object identifies the apmExceptionEntry that specified the threshold. The apmTransactionResponsiveness variable identifies the actual transaction and its responsiveness. Agent implementors are urged to include additional data objects in the alarm that may explain the reason for the alarm. It is helpful to include such data in the alarm because it describes the situation at the time the alarm was generated, where polls after the fact may not provide meaningful information. Examples of such information are CPU load, memory utilization, network utilization, and transaction statistics. |
|
.1.3.6.1.2.1.16.23.0.2 |
Notification sent when a transaction is unsuccessful.
The index of the included apmExceptionResponsivenessThreshold object identifies both the type of the transaction that caused this notification as well as the apmExceptionEntry that specified the threshold. Agent implementors are urged to include additional data objects in the alarm that may explain the reason for the alarm. It is helpful to include such data in the alarm because it describes the situation at the time the alarm was generated, where polls after the fact may not provide meaningful information. Examples of such information are CPU load, memory utilization, network utilization, and transaction statistics. |
